The Mayo on the header tank cap - could be due to the car only ever having done mainly short runs, not getting hot enough. So I would clean the cap up and then keep a careful eye on it. The real issue with Mayo is when the oil starts to look like that, that is almost certainly the early signs of the Head Gasket starting to go, so regular oil level checks are good.
